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Provide service and customer support during field visits and onsite print trials.
- Travel to customer sites to perform equipment installation repair maintenance and testing.
- Diagnose technical issues determine and implement proper solutions.
- Provide pre-sales samples for future business opportunities.
- Create and modify graphics appropriate for the best images for customer samples.
- Performs basic experiments and tests on varied electromechanical systems in a laboratory environment.
- Performs basic set up of equipment in a laboratory environment.
- Correlates and reports results and observations of testing and experiments to engineering using databases and spreadsheet computer programs.
- Produce timely and detailed service reports.
- Works from written/verbal instructions specifications technical manuals and engineering sketches.
- Uses a variety of imaging equipment and software associated with image manipulation. Basic repairs to test equipment and components if applicable.
- Performs testing of customized inkjet systems.
- Assembles disassembles modifies reworks refurbishes repairs reassembles and tests units as required using:
- Blueprints sketches engineering specifications and standard testing equipment applying knowledge of mechanical electrical and optical interrelations.
- Compiles and records test results.
- Usage of computer skills such as Excel Word and database applications.
- Works closely with customers engineers and senior technicians.
- Travel domestically and abroad Extensive travel may be required.
